What Makes a Steel Tube Pipe Industrial-Grade?
There’s no magic fairy dust here, just good old fashioned metallurgy and precision manufacturing. Industrial-grade steel tubes are typically cold-rolled or hot-rolled, with varying strengths according to ASTM and ISO standards. For the uninitiated, ASTM A53 and A106 are commonly referenced standards that dictate chemical composition, tensile strength, and dimensional tolerances.
From my experience on the factory floor, the product design often revolves around the expected load and the environment. For example, pipes used in chemical plants usually get a special corrosion-resistant alloy treatment on top, or they’re clad with an additional coating. Others, like those in structural frameworks, prioritize dimensional accuracy and weldability.
Many engineers I know swear by the versatility of seamless versus welded steel tubes. Seamless tubes are slightly pricier but indispensable where high pressure and safety are non-negotiable. Welded tubes, meanwhile, can be customized more easily and come in thicker gauges, depending on need.

Technical Specifications That Matter
From dimensional tolerances to tensile strength, knowing the specs is crucial. Here's a quick rundown of typical steel tube pipe characteristics you’ll often evaluate:
| Property |
Typical Value / Range |
Notes |
| Outer Diameter (OD) |
10mm – 610mm |
Varies by standard and application |
| Wall Thickness |
1mm – 40mm |
Thicker for high pressure or structural uses |
| Tensile Strength |
350 – 700 MPa |
Depends on grade and heat treatment |
| Length |
Up to 12 meters standard |
Custom cuts widely available |
| Material Grade |
API 5L, ASTM A53, A106, EN 10210 |
Choose according to industry use |
